Sie sind auf Seite 1von 45

INSTITUTO TECNOLOGICO DE CD.

MADERO
INGENIERIA INDUSTRIAL

SISTEMAS DE AUTOMATIZACIÓN
UNIDAD I
“CIRCUITOS LÓGICOS PROGRAMABLES”
Profesora:
MII Elsa Margarita Mijares Fong

DOMINGUEZ GONZÁLEZ JOAQUIN LASTRA ZALETA DIDIER


08070629 08070566
PACHECO CRUZ VICTOR ARTURO SÁNCHEZ GONZALEZ ANA PAOLA
08070570 08070572
 OBJETIVO DE LA UNIDAD:
Analizar los conceptos básicos de los circuitos lógicos programables
PLC´s que sirven para controlar y programar los elementos de un
sistema automatizado de manufactura en las empresas de clase
mundial.

Diseñar y planear la lógica cableada y la lógica programada para


distribuir las señales de inputs y outputs que activaran o
desactivaran cada elemento de un sistema de manufactura en el
momento oportuno para que su operación sea perfectamente
sincronizada
 OBJETIVO DEL TEMA:
Dar a conocer una introducción sobre los circuitos lógicos
programables (PLC’s).
Mostrando su clasificación, marcas, precios, así como la historia de los
PLC.
 DEFINICIÓN
Un PLC (Controlador Lógico Programable) en sí es una máquina
electrónica la cual es capaz de controlar máquinas e incluso
procesos a través de entradas y salidas. Las entradas y las salidas
pueden ser tanto analógicas como digitales.
 El PLC apareció a finales de los años 60, con el propósito de
eliminar el enorme costo que significaba el reemplazo de un
sistema de control basado en relés (interruptor operado
magnéticamente).
El primer PLC fue designado 084, debido a que fue el proyecto
ochenta y cuatro de Bedford Associates. Bedford Associates creo
una nueva compañía dedicada al desarrollo, manufactura, venta y
servicio para este nuevo producto: Modicon (MOdular DIgital
CONtroller o Controlador Digital Modular). Una de las personas que
trabajo en ese proyecto fue Dick Morley.

A mediados de los años 70, los PLC´s AMD 2901 y 2903 eran muy
populares entre los PLC MODICON. Por esos tiempos los
microprocesadores no eran tan rápidos y sólo podían acoplarse a
PLCs pequeños.
.
El controlador Programable tiene la estructura típica de muchos
sistemas programables, como por ejemplo una microcomputadora.
La estructura básica del hardware de un controlador Programable
propiamente dicho esta constituido por:
•+ 5 V para alimentar a todas las tarjetas
•+ 5.2 V para alimentar al programador
•+ 24 V para los canales de lazo de corriente 20 mA.

+ 5 V para alimentar a todas las tarjetas


+ 5.2 V para alimentar al programador
+ 24 V para los canales de lazo de corriente
20 mA
PLC tipo nano:

o Generalmente PLC de tipo compacto


(Fuente, CPU e I/O integradas) que puede manejar un conjunto
reducido de I/O, generalmente en un número inferior a 100.
o Permiten manejar entradas y salidas digitales y algunos
módulos especiales.
PLC tipo Compactos:
Estos PLC tienen incorporado la Fuente de Alimentación, su
CPU y módulos de I/O en un solo módulo principal y
permiten manejar desde unas pocas I/O hasta varios
cientos ( alrededor de 500 I/O ) , su tamaño es superior a
los Nano PLC y soportan una gran variedad de módulos
especiales
PLC tipo modulares:
Están compuestos por módulos o tarjetas adosadas a
rack con funciones definidas:
CPU, fuente de alimentación, módulos de (I/O) entradas y
salidas, etc.
 Es la parte más compleja e imprescindible del controlador
programable.
 Su misión es leer los estados de las señales de las entradas,
ejecutar el programa de control y gobernar las salidas, el
procesamiento es permanente y a gran velocidad.
 La unidad central esta
diseñado a base de
microprocesadores y
memorias; contiene una
unidad de control, la memoria
interna del programador RAM,
temporizadores, contadores,
memorias internas tipo relé,
imágenes del proceso
entradas/salidas, etc.
 Son los que proporciona el vínculo entre el CPU del controlador y
los dispositivos de campo del sistema. A través de ellos se origina el
intercambio de información ya sea para la adquisición de datos o la
del mando para el control de máquinas del proceso.
 Debido a que existen gran variedad de dispositivos exteriores
(captadores actuadores), encontramos diferentes tipos de módulos
de entrada y salidas, cada uno de los cuales sirve para manejar
cierto tipo de señal (discreta o análoga) a determinado valor de
tensión o de corriente en DC o AC.
Los módulos de entrada y salida tienen la misión de proteger y aislar la etapa de control que
esta conformada principalmente por el microcontrolador del PLC, de todos los elementos que
se encuentran fuera de la unidad central de proceso ya sean sensores o actuadores

Físicamente los módulos de entrada y salida de salida de datos, están construidos en


tarjetas de circuitos impresos que contienen los dispositivos electrónicos capaces de
aislar al PLC con el entorno exterior, además de contar con indicadores luminosos que
informan de manera visual el estado que guardan las entradas y salidas.
 A los módulos de entrada de datos se hacen llegar las señales que generan los sensores
 Módulos de entrada de datos discretos.- Estos responden tan solo a dos valores
diferentes de una señal que puede generar el sensor. Las señales pueden ser las
siguientes:
 a) El sensor manifiesta cierta cantidad de energía diferente de cero si detecta algo.
 b) Energía nula si no presenta detección de algo.
 Un ejemplo de sensor que se emplean en este tipo de módulo es el que se utiliza para
detectar el final de carrera del vástago de un pistón.

Para este tipo de módulos de entradas


discretas, en uno de sus bornes se tiene que
conectar de manera común una de las
terminales de los sensores, para ello tenemos
que ubicar cual es la terminal común de los
módulos de entrada.
 Módulos de entrada de datos analógicos.- Otro tipo de módulo de entrada es el
que en su circuitería contiene un convertidor analógico – digital (ADC), para que
en función del sensor que tenga conectado, vaya interpretando las distintas
magnitudes de la variable física que sé esta midiendo y las digitalice, para que
posteriormente estos datos sean transportados al microcontrolador del PLC. Un
ejemplo de sensor que se emplean con este tipo de módulo es el que mide
temperatura.
 Son dispositivos destinados a guardar información de manera
provisional o permanente. Se cuenta con dos tipos de memorias:
Volátiles (RAM) y No volátiles (EPROM y EEPROM)
 Las terminales de programación, son el medio de comunicación
entre el hombre y la máquina; estos aparatos están constituidos por
teclados y dispositivos de visualización.

 Existen tres tipos de programadores los manuales (Hand Held) tipo


de calculadora, los de video tipo (PC), y la (computadora).
BENEFICIOS
o Menor cableado, reduce los costos y los tiempos de parada de
planta.
o Mínimo espacio de ocupación.
o Menor costo de mano de obra.
o Posibilidad de gobernar varias máquinas con el mismo autómata.
o Menor tiempo de puesta en funcionamiento.
o Flexibilidad de configuración y programación, lo que permite adaptar
fácilmente la automatización a los cambios del proceso.

INCONVENIENTES
o Adiestramiento de técnicos.
o Costo.
 Borne es el nombre dado en electricidad a cada uno de los
terminales de metal en que suelen terminar algunas máquinas y
aparatos eléctricos, y que se emplean para su conexión a los hilos
conductores.

Tipos de bomeras usadas para el Diferentes ejemplos para identificar el


cableado de los elementos controlados cableado de un PLC
por un PLC.
La dirección en el flujo de datos de los
módulos depende si estos son de
entrada ó de salida, lo que es común
entre los módulos de entrada y salida
son los bornes en donde se conectan
físicamente ya sean los sensores o
los actuadores, el número de bornes
que puede tener un módulo depende
del modelo de PLC ya que existen
comercialmente módulos de 8, 16 ó
32 terminales

En los bornes de conexión de estos módulos de entrada o salida están


conectadas las señales que generan los sensores ó las que manipularán los
actuadores, que tienen como misión vigilar y manipulan el proceso que sé esta
automatizado con el PLC
a) Al encender el procesador, auto chequeo
de encendido e inhabilita las salidas.
b) Lee y almacena en una memoria llamada
tabla de imagen de entradas
c) El PLC modifica una zona especial de
memoria llamada tabla de imagen de
salida.
d) d) El procesador actualiza el estado de las
salidas "copiando" hacia los módulos de
salida el estado de la tabla de imagen de
salidas
e) e) Vuelve paso b)
 1) Auto chequeo de Fallas
 2) Inicializaciones
 3) Salvaguarda de Estados
 4) Modularidad
 Dentro de las ventajas que estos equipos poseen se
encuentra que, gracias a ellos, es posible ahorrar tiempo
en la elaboración de proyectos, pudiendo realizar
modificaciones sin costos adicionales. Por otra parte, son
de tamaño reducido y mantenimiento de bajo costo,
además permiten ahorrar dinero en mano de obra y la
posibilidad de controlar más de una máquina con el mismo
equipo.
 Por ejemplo, si es necesario cambiar los circuitos de un sistema de
alambrado duro para que el interruptor 1 controle la lámpara 2, y el
interruptor 2 a la lámpara 1, tomaría varios minutos realizar el
recableado, involucrando además el cambio de los alambres en las
lámparas o en los interruptores. Con un PLC, una simple operación
puede realizar estos cambios internamente en el programa,
eliminando la necesidad de recablear, tomando así unicamente una
fracción de tiempo que el cambio de un sistema de cableado duro.
 Sin embargo, y como sucede
en todos los casos, los
controladores lógicos
programables, o PLC’s,
presentan ciertas
desventajas como es la
necesidad de contar con
técnicos cualificados y
adiestrados específicamente
para ocuparse de su buen
funcionamiento.
Allen Bradley
$ 3,50000

Mitsubishi
MODELO COMPACTO
$ 2,50000
 CPU 224XP, ALIMENTACION DC
14 ED DC/10 SD DC, 2 EA, 1 SA,
8/16 KB PROGR./10 KB DATOS,
2 PUERTOS PPI/PROGR.
INTERF
Modelos compactos

Schneider
Telemecanique
$ 2,00000
CPU226, 24 VDC, ENTRADAS 24 VDC,
SAL 24 VDC, MEM 8KBITE 24DI/16DO,
2xPPI

GE Fanuc
$ 2,00000
CPU 224XP, ALIMENTACION AC 14 ED
DC/10 SD RELE,2 EA, 1 SA, 12/16 KB
PROGR./10 KB DATOS, 2 PUERTOS
PPI/PROGR. INTERF
MODELO NANO:
CPU224, 110/220VAC, ENTRADAS 24
VDC, SAL RELE, MEM 8KBITE
14DI/10DO

Bosh Rexroth
$ 1,45000

MODELO MODULAR:

Plc Abb
$ 3,25000
CPU 313C, CPU COMPACTA CON 1xMPI
+ 1xRS485, ALIMENTACION 24VDC, 16DI
24VDC/16DO 24VDC, 32KBYTES, 3
CONTADORES(30 KHZ), REQUIERE
MICRO MEMORY CARD Y 1 X
CONECTOR 40 POLOS
Los primeros PLC fueron diseñados para ser usados por
electricistas que podían aprender a programarlos en el
trabajo. Estos PLC eran programados con “lógica de
escalera” (ladder logic).
 Cuando hablamos de los lenguajes de programación nos
referimos a diferentes formas en las que se puede escribir
el programa del usuario. Los software actuales nos
permiten traducir el programa usuario de un lenguaje a
otro.
 Los PLC en la primera mitad de los 80’s , eran
programados usando terminales de programación
especializadas, que a menudo tenían teclas de funciones
que representaban los elementos lógicos de los
programas de PLC.
 Los PLC modernos pueden ser programados de muchas
formas, desde la lógica de escalera hasta lenguajes de
programación tradicionales como el BASIC o C.

 Otro método es usar la Lógica de Estados (State Logic) y


un lenguaje de programación de alto nivel diseñado
especialmente para programar PLC basándose en los
diagramas de transición de estados.
 Cuando hablamos de los lenguajes de programación nos
referimos a diferentes formas en las que se puede escribir
el programa del usuario.

 Los software actuales nos permiten traducir el programa


usuario de un lenguaje a otro, pudiendo así escribir el
programa en el lenguaje que más nos conviene.
 IEC 61131-3 es el primer esfuerzo real para estandarizar
los lenguajes de programación usados para la
automatización industrial.. Con su soporte mundial.
 Recientemente, el estándar internacional IEC 61131-3
se está volviendo muy popular. IEC 61131-3 define
cinco lenguajes de programación para los sistemas de
control programables:
 FBD (Function block diagram)
 LD (Ladder diagram)
 ST (Structured text, similar al lenguaje de programación
Pascal)
 IL (Instruction list)
 SFC (Sequential function chart).
 Los lenguajes consisten en dos de tipo literal y
TIPO DE GRAFICO

 Literales:

Lista de instrucciones (IL).


Texto estructurado (ST).

 Gráficos:
Diagrama de contactos (LD).
Diagrama de bloques funcionales (FBD).
 Function Block Diagram (diagrama de funcion )
se basa en bloques que realizan operaciones
matemáticas simples para poder determinar una salida.

Su estructura es de entradas y salidas:


Una variable de entrada.
Una salida de un bloque y la entrada de otro bloque.
Una variable de salida y una salida de un bloque

 La lógica del programa se logra al interconectar los


bloques.
ladder Diagram: Es un lenguaje gráfico que se parece
mucho a los diagramas en escalera que se acostumbran
en el control convencional. Su lógica incluye los conceptos
de contactos normalmente abiertos, normalmente
cerrados, salidas hacia bobinas,(SET) (JUMP) (NC) etc.
 Structured Text es un lenguaje de marcas ligero creado
para escribir textos de manera cómoda y rápida. Tiene la
principal ventaja de que ese texto puede usarse para
generar documentos equivalentes en HTML, TeX, docbook
u otros lenguajes.
 Instruction list es uno de los 5 idiomas admitidos por la
norma IEC 61131-3 estándar.
consiste es una programación por texto, en la cual se le
indica al CPU la operación a realizar mediante un
comando. Los comandos que se pueden utilizar están
predeterminados por el fabricante.
 Sequential function chart
 (Diagrama de funciones Secuenciales ) es un lenguaje de
programación gráfica que se utiliza para el PLC. Es uno de
los cinco idiomas definidos por la norma IEC 61131-3 .
 www.itescam.edu.mx
 Antología de sistemas de automatización
Autores: MII Elsa Margarita Mijares Fong
MII Blanca Nelva Castillo Bolaños.
 Introducción a los autómatas programables
Joan Domingo Peña, Juan Gámiz Caro, Antoni
Grau i Saldes, Herminio Martínez García.

Das könnte Ihnen auch gefallen